RSB stands for "Return Stack Buffer" in industry literature[1]. Update
the kernel Kconfig to use this standard term instead of the current
"Return-Speculation-Buffer".

This change aligns kernel documentation with widely accepted terminology.

The line length reduction triggers text reformatting, but no functional
text is altered.

+	  SKL Return-Stack-Buffer (RSB) underflow issue. The mitigation is off
+	  by default and needs to be enabled on the kernel command line via the
+	  retbleed=stuff option. For non-affected systems the overhead of this
+	  option is marginal as the call depth tracking is using run-time
+	  generated call thunks in a compiler generated padding area and call
+	  patching. This increases text size by ~5%. For non affected systems
+	  this space is unused. On affected SKL systems this results in a
+	  significant performance gain over the IBRS mitigation.
